Article: The start of something big Former Tiger makes splash for Rangers.

KANSAS CITY - The rookie second baseman sits alone in front of his stall in the visitor's locker room. Legs spread in front of him and right elbow resting on his thigh, Ian Kinsler looks down in concentration at his hand-held Tiger Woods Golf video game.

He has time. It's 3:30 p.m., 31/2 hours before game time. Teammates are scattered about the clubhouse. A handful sit around a table playing cards. Some are slumped into one of the over-stuffed couches watching "Dumb and Dumber."

Kinsler arrived at Kauffman Stadium at 1:45 p.m. to take early batting practice with hitting coach Rudy Jaramillo. After that, he settles in.
